McLaren's 2015 car passes crash tests

– McLaren has confirmed that its 2015 car has passed all of the mandatory FIA crash tests, over six weeks before the first test of the season in Spain.All Formula 1 cars must pass every FIA crash test prior to being deemed fit for use and McLaren confirmed on its official Twitter account that the MP4-30 had completed the requirement.McLaren's MP4-30 will be its first machine powered by Honda in over two decades as the Japanese manufacturer returns to Formula 1.The Woking-based squad confirmed on Thursday that Fernando Alonso and Jenson Button will race the MP4-30, with Kevin Magnussen occupying a test and reserve role.
